Incident Narrative

An employee was walking, tripped on an electrical cord and fell injuring the left hip and leg.

Incident Summary

On September 14, 2015, a worker at XLC Services in DESOTO, TEXAS suffered soreness, pain, hurt-nonspecified injury to the hip(s) and leg(s). The incident was classified as fall on same level due to tripping over an object, with floor, n.e.c. identified as the source of injury. The worker was hospitalized.
